Position Details / Job Purpose
The purpose of this role is to support the \”Logistics Coordinator\” with their role in carrying out the daily planning and routing for the Company\’s own fleet of delivery vehicles and keep the sales team and driver team informed throughout the day. This is a very key role for Transport as it provides the vital link between the deliveries, sales team, drivers and customers. In short, the mission for each day is to get every delivery to site on time and in full, whatever takes to fulfil in the most efficient way. The company has supplied the servicing the fit out and construction industry for many years and has grown to stock over 5800 key lines, in stock and ready for dispatch to sites nationwide.
Key Responsibilities
- Communicating with drivers as they go about their day.
- Communicating with sales on all aspects of deliveries and delivery information.
- Organising any external and extra transport, including booking pallet network deliveries (keeping records of these too).
- Organising drivers to cover the day’s deliveries (including booking agency/ temp drivers).
- Day to day preparation for the routing in the evening (including but not limited to checking weights, dates and noting special requirements).
- Organising collections from suppliers and customer’s sites.
- Managing feedback from drivers to sales and vice versa.
- Carrying out the daily routing schedule at the end of each day – accumulating all orders and planning them suitably for loading then delivering the next day.
- Managing delivery issues via \”green forms\” – communicating, producing and advising from them.
- Ensuring completed arrival of drivers with collections being booked in.
- Booking in and advising on any special requirements.
- Completing drivers information after routing – start time, vehicle and paperwork.
- Raising purchase orders for 3rd party transport suppliers.
- Supporting warehouse supervisor when required.
